National Times Bureau :- In a targeted drive against power theft, the Jalandhar Circle Electricity Department conducted a large-scale inspection across five divisions, penalizing 33 consumers for illegal electricity use and system misuse. 1,242 Connections Inspected, 33 Defaulters Fined Special checking teams inspected 1,242 electricity connections, identifying 33 cases involving direct theft, overloading, and unauthorized commercial use of domestic power connections. A cumulative fine of ₹8.53 lakh has been imposed on the defaulters.
